Which of the following responses is appropriate for a security guard dealing with an emergency situation?

Following established response protocols is the appropriate response for a security guard dealing with an emergency situation. These protocols are designed to ensure a systematic and efficient approach to handling emergencies, providing a clear framework for actions that need to be taken. This includes assessing the situation, ensuring safety, notifying appropriate authorities, and documenting events as they unfold. Adhering to these protocols helps manage the situation effectively while minimizing risks to both the security guard and others involved.

In contrast, ignoring the situation fails to address the potential harm and disregards the responsibility of the guard to protect people and property. Calling personal friends for advice is unprofessional and may lead to incorrect or delayed responses. Taking no action until management arrives can prolong the emergency situation and exacerbate risks, as immediate action may be necessary to ensure safety. Therefore, following established response protocols is essential for effective emergency management.
